Output 3427c46e275c551693bf2639e8ad54530321b3f6abb216c0e18b6cb22854bc62:17

value
682824
script pubkey
OP_0 OP_PUSHBYTES_20 ab7dc2ab2fe26b8d80dbc791969a92dcc28ed34a
address
bc1q4d7u92e0uf4cmqxmc7gedx5jmnpga562ra4l2z
transaction
3427c46e275c551693bf2639e8ad54530321b3f6abb216c0e18b6cb22854bc62
confirmations
77718
spent
true